海角社区 INRA hosts UGlobe team from Utrecht University

海角社区 INRA hosts UGlobe team from Utrecht University (Netherlands)for Erasmus Exchange Program.

海角社区 INRA hosted some members of  the UGlobe from Utrecht University (Netherlands), from 30 May-3rd June 2024 for an Erasmus Exchange Program. The purpose of the exchange program, was to further strengthen the organisations’ partnership around Just Transitions. The partnership meetings organised for the visiting team included, visits to University of Ghana’s Vice Chancellor’s  office, Law, Economics Departments, LEAD for Ghana, a not-for-profit leadership development and network social enterprise, domiciled in Accra. 

Field visits also included visits to green entrepreneurs including SESA, an organisation that develops recycling programs for plastics, aluminium, and papers and cardboards and Ebapreneur Solutions, who are into production of briquettes, solar dryers and other green innovations. Another key visit was to the Accra Compost and Recycling Plant (ACARP), the first state-of the art waste sorting and composting facility in West Africa. 

These field visits were to increase awareness of grassroots initiatives that are contributing to curb Ghana’s environment, climate and natural resource management initiatives.
